With reference to latter (Ref.87/17/10) which was addressed to you by the Foreign Office on the 18th March 1920 regarding the institution of a uniform system for the control of the export of Opium and Kindred Drugs to foreign countries, I am directed by the board of Trade to transmit for the Secretary of State's information, copy of correspon- dence between this Department and the India Office regarding the suggested extension of this scheme to exports from India.
